On Wed, Nov 28, 2018 at 05:30:10PM +0800, Chen-Yu Tsai wrote: > The RTC module on the H3 was claimed to be the same as on the A31, when > in fact it is not. The A31 does not have an RTC external clock output, > and its internal RC oscillator's average clock rate is not in the same > range. The H5's RTC has some extra crypto-related registers compared to > the H3. Their exact functions are not clear. Also the RTC-VIO regulator > has different settings. > > This patch fixes the compatible string and clock properties to conform > to the updated bindings. The device node for the internal oscillator is > removed, as it is internalized into the RTC device. Clock references to > the IOSC and LOSC are also fixed. > > Signed-off-by: Chen-Yu Tsai <wens@csie.org>
